vscode 格式化 (). 后会自动换行 怎么解决
时间: 2023-03-20 16:02:23 浏览: 1365
你可以尝试在 VSCode 的设置中找到 `"editor.wordWrap": "off"` 这个选项并将其设置为 `"on"`。这将禁止编辑器在文本行的末尾自动换行,使得括号后面的内容不会自动换行。你也可以通过按下 `Ctrl + Shift + P` 并输入 "Toggle Word Wrap" 来手动切换自动换行功能。
相关问题
vscode怎么控制格式化时单行换行长度
在VS Code中,可以使用以下设置来控制格式化时单行换行的长度:
1. 打开VS Code,并进入“设置”(快捷键:Ctrl + ,)。
2. 在搜索栏中输入“editor.wordWrap”,找到“Editor: Word Wrap”选项。
3. 将其设置为“on”。
4. 在搜索栏中输入“editor.wordWrapColumn”,找到“Editor: Word Wrap Column”选项。
5. 将其设置为所需的单行换行长度,例如80或120。
这样设置后,当你格式化代码时,单行代码将会在达到指定长度时自动换行。
vscode怎么格式化代码让代码自动换行
### 配置 VSCode 实现代码格式化时自动换行
为了使VSCode在格式化代码时实现自动换行,需调整相应设置来控制每种语言的格式化行为。
对于HTML文件,在`setting.json`中指定默认格式化工具有助于统一管理不同类型的文件格式化方式[^1]:
```json
{
"editor.defaultFormatter": "vscode.html-language-features"
}
```
当希望特定情况下触发自动换行功能时,则应关注单行字符数量阈值参数。通过修改该参数可以影响到实际编码过程中是否会因超出长度而发生折行现象[^2]。具体操作如下:
按 `Ctrl + ,` 进入全局设置界面并查找与目标语言有关联的格式选项;比如针对HTML而言就是寻找名为 `"html.format.wrapLineLength"` 的属性,并将其数值设定在一个合理范围内以满足需求——通常这个值代表的就是允许的最大列宽,一旦超过就会强制换行显示内容。
另外一种方法适用于使用Vetur插件的情况,特别是Vue项目开发场景下更为常见。此时可以在`settings.json`里加入下面这段配置语句确保JavaScript/TypeScript以及CSS部分同样遵循相同的换行政策[^3]:
```json
{
"vetur.format.options.printWidth": 80,
"[vue]": {
"editor.defaultFormatter": "octref.vetur"
}
}
```
上述例子中的`printWidth`即指定了最大宽度为80个字符,用户可以根据实际情况自行调整此数字大小。
阅读全文
相关推荐
![pdf](https://img-home.csdnimg.cn/images/20241231044930.png)
![pdf](https://img-home.csdnimg.cn/images/20241231044930.png)
![pdf](https://img-home.csdnimg.cn/images/20241231044930.png)
![pdf](https://img-home.csdnimg.cn/images/20241231044930.png)
![rar](https://img-home.csdnimg.cn/images/20241231044955.png)
![docx](https://img-home.csdnimg.cn/images/20241231044901.png)
![zip](https://img-home.csdnimg.cn/images/20241231045053.png)
![zip](https://img-home.csdnimg.cn/images/20241231045053.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)